CareGo named finalist in international “steel excellence” competition for the third year in a row

CareGo has been named a finalist in the category of “Best Innovation: Process” in American Metal Market’s annual Awards for Steel Excellence competition.

“Best Innovation: Process” is a new and highly competitive category that was introduced for this year’s competition.

The prestigious international competition is open to steel mills, metal service centres, ports and companies that work within the metal industry such as CareGo. The winner will be announced June 14 in New York City.

CareGo’s award application described its patent-pending disruptive TELIA technology that allows more steel to be stored in the same amount of space, speeds up loading and unloading, increases employee productivity while creating a safer workplace, and virtually eliminates the risk of product damage.

It’s an honour to be chosen again and we’re very pleased,” says president and CEO Demetrius Tsafaridis. “Our optimization and automation tools revolutionize the way steel coil, pipe and tube are handled and we welcome this opportunity to share our story.”

The award competition is judged by senior executives in the global steel industry. American Metal Marketis an industry magazine, daily news web site and metals conference provider based in New York City.
